How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Dallas County?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Dallas County Studio Apartments | $1,391 | $556 | $10,000+ |
| Dallas County 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,535 | $575 | $10,000+ |
| Dallas County 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,067 | $669 | $10,000+ |
| Dallas County 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,775 | $765 | $10,000+ |
| Dallas County 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,938 | $1,279 | $10,000+ |
| Dallas County 5 Bedroom Apartments | $10,681 | $2,395 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Dallas County Apartments
What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in Dallas County?
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in Dallas County is at Costa Bella Apartments listed at $575.
How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Dallas County Apartment?
The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Dallas County is $2,440.
What is the largest Pet Friendly Dallas County Apartment for rent?
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Dallas County is a 8,880 square feet unit starting from $2,659 at 2922 Elm St.
What is the average size for Dallas County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Dallas County is currently at 672 sq ft.
